      Cup Diameter

      The Schilke 14A4aHeavyweight has a cup diameter of 17.09 mm compared to 17.00 mm on the Monette Vintage D2L S1 — a difference of +0.09 mm. A wider cup generally produces a fuller, darker tone but requires more air support.

      Cup Depth

      The Schilke 14A4aHeavyweight has a shallow cup while the Monette Vintage D2L S1 has a very shallow cup. Deeper cups favor a darker, richer sound; shallower cups provide more brightness and easier upper register.

      Throat Diameter

      Throat diameters are essentially identical at 3.66 mm, so resistance feel will be comparable.
